Abstract

Described systems and methods allow protecting a host system, such as a computer or smartphone, from malware. In some embodiments, an anti-malware application installs a hypervisor, which displaces an operating system executing on the host system to a guest virtual machine (VM). The hypervisor further creates a set of virtual containers (VC), by setting up a memory domain for each VC, isolated from the memory domain of the guest VM. The hypervisor then maps a memory image of a malware scanner to each VC. When a target object is selected for scanning, the anti-malware application launches the malware scanner. Upon intercepting the launch, the hypervisor switches the memory context of the malware scanner to the memory domain of a selected VC, for the duration of the scan. Thus, malware scanning is performed within an isolated environment.
